Url proyecto .net

07/02/2005 - 12:05 por Beatriz Ramos | Informe spam
Hola, necesito saber cual es la url donde se ejecuta mi proyecto .NET. Es
decir http://localhost/Gastos o http://Gastos... Con server.mappath solo he
conseguido sacar la ubicacion de éste (C:/inetpub/wwroot...)

Gracias.

Preguntas similare

Leer las respuestas

#1 Ivan Pascual
07/02/2005 - 12:21 | Informe spam
Hola Beatriz!
la URL de tu proyecto es http://localhost/Gastos

C:/inetpub/wwroot --> http://localhost/

Ivan Pascual
Respuesta Responder a este mensaje
#2 Jorge Serrano [MVP VB]
07/02/2005 - 12:35 | Informe spam
Hola Beatriz,

debes utilizar algo similar a:
Response.Write(Request.ServerVariables("SERVER_NAME"))

Esto te dará el nombre del servidor (localhost) por defecto.

Una información muy útil sobre esto, lo encontrarás en:
http://west-wind.com/weblog/posts/269.aspx

Un saludo,

Jorge Serrano Pérez
MVP VB.NET


"Beatriz Ramos" wrote:

Hola, necesito saber cual es la url donde se ejecuta mi proyecto .NET. Es
decir http://localhost/Gastos o http://Gastos... Con server.mappath solo he
conseguido sacar la ubicacion de éste (C:/inetpub/wwroot...)

Gracias.
Respuesta Responder a este mensaje
#3 Beatriz Ramos
10/02/2005 - 17:29 | Informe spam
Hola Jorge, muchas gracias. La página me ha sido muy útil, de hecho la he
agregado a mis favoritos. El problema es q por ejemplo la url de mi proyecto
es http:\\Gastos y es lo q deseo obtener en vez de
http:\\NOMBRE_MAQUINA\Gastos.

Un saludo.
Respuesta Responder a este mensaje
#4 Beatriz Ramos
22/02/2005 - 10:35 | Informe spam
Hola, conseguí solucionarlo con la siguiente linea

Mid(Request.Url.AbsoluteUri, 1, (Request.Url.AbsoluteUri.Length -
Request.Url.AbsolutePath.Length) + 1)

Esto me devuelve la ruta relativa del proyecto.

Gracias y un saludo

"Beatriz Ramos" wrote:

Hola Jorge, muchas gracias. La página me ha sido muy útil, de hecho la he
agregado a mis favoritos. El problema es q por ejemplo la url de mi proyecto
es http:\\Gastos y es lo q deseo obtener en vez de
http:\\NOMBRE_MAQUINA\Gastos.

Un saludo.

Respuesta Responder a este mensaje
#5 Beatriz Ramos
22/02/2005 - 12:25 | Informe spam
Hola, así es mejor:

Funcion q devuelve la raiz de la url del proyecto.

Public Sub LeerVarServidor(ByRef sInsSQL As String, ByRef sBBDD As String)

Dim archivo As New StreamReader(Server.MapPath("\SolicitudCompras\")
& "Variables.ini")
sInsSQL = archivo.ReadLine
sBBDD = archivo.ReadLine
archivo.Close()

End Sub

"Beatriz Ramos" wrote:

Hola, necesito saber cual es la url donde se ejecuta mi proyecto .NET. Es
decir http://localhost/Gastos o http://Gastos... Con server.mappath solo he
conseguido sacar la ubicacion de éste (C:/inetpub/wwroot...)

Gracias.
email Siga el debate Respuesta Responder a este mensaje
Ads by Google
Help Hacer una preguntaRespuesta Tengo una respuesta
Search Busqueda sugerida